Quick insights from ofsted Powered by AI

This insight was generated by AI, based on latest Ofsted report.

Diverse Books and Toys: Staff support children's interest in books. Older children have favourite stories that they ask staff to read.
Indoor and Outdoor Facilities: Children play in a safe and welcoming environment. Staff ensure that individual dietary needs are known and addressed.
Activities: Children play cooperatively, share, take turns, and understand and express their emotions.
Skills , Knowledge and Behavior: Older children express themselves confidently. They make decisions about whether to play indoors or outdoors.
Communication: Partnerships with parents are strong. Parents are very happy with their children's progress and methods of communication.
Programs and Resources: Children who speak English as an additional language receive good support in using their home languages while gaining speaking skills in English.
Staff Training: Staff identify that recent training on how to use a speech and language toolkit has helped them to assess children's language development and ensure early intervention.
Welcoming and Professional Staff: Relationships between the staff and children are good. Staff know the children well as individuals and meet their care and learning needs effectively.
Safeguarding Training: Staff complete training to keep their child protection knowledge up to date. They are aware of the signs of abuse and neglect.
Play and Learning Integration: Children learn about safety. Staff choose monitors at the beginning of each day to help them complete the outdoor risk assessment.
Diversity Management: Children gain an understanding of diversity. They learn about communities, families and traditions beyond their own experience.
Transition to Primary School: Children develop good skills that help them to be ready for the eventual move on to school.
Child Safety Management: Staff identify and successfully minimise potential risks indoors and outdoors.
Children's Safety and Security: The premises are secure so that children cannot leave unsupervised and unwanted visitors cannot gain access.
Teaching Personal Safety: They talk with children about why and how they should care for their teeth.
Happiness and Settling: Children play in a safe and welcoming environment. Staff build strong bonds with the children and ensure that children understand expectations for behaviour.
Nutritional Menu: Children eat healthy food, and staff ensure that individual dietary needs are known and addressed.

From the Precious Wings
We are a young nursery with traditional values that hold that every child is special, gifted, and academically savvy.
Precious Wings wants to make sure that all kids have the same learning chances and opportunity to develop their wings so they can fly high. For our kids, we wanted to create something exceptional and one-of-a-kind that would help each child reach their full potential, improve the early years for all kids, and make a difference.
I want to communicate and explore without worrying that I'll make a mistake, which helps me gain more confidence.
to give each child with individualised daycare, early childhood education, and play opportunities. Both our employees and kids should be learning.
Precious Wings employs a variety of pedagogical techniques to meet each child's unique learning needs. We blend Harkness, Regio, and Montessori.
